Transaction 76cefcd79a950a63006a413d94dd251d59dc27e4681a3c402e55ef2f67c8d680

3 Input
2 Outputs
  • 76cefcd79a950a63006a413d94dd251d59dc27e4681a3c402e55ef2f67c8d680:0
  • value  1207800
    address  18GnXugkaeHYaM8rE4CyZA6CYqNvZNGHxU
  • 76cefcd79a950a63006a413d94dd251d59dc27e4681a3c402e55ef2f67c8d680:1
  • value  3369041
    address  bc1qnvecd8xq6e84pt4dt4u44t2hjphuaf04k2n0wl